MY ILLUSTRIOUS WASTELAND Plays 10/1-10 At American Theatre Of Actors

Movie stars are sainted, anti-depressants are mandatory, and a tiny computer resides in every good citizen's brain. My Illustrious Wasteland-equal parts sci-fi epic, social satire, and high-energy rock show-is an exhilarating ride through a wildly imagined future America.

SPRING AWAKENING's Wright Joins NYMF's GAY BRIDE OF FRANKENSTEIN, Runs 9/28-10/11

Jonathan B. Wright (Spring Awakening - Broadway original cast, Nick and Norah's Infinite Playlist, Youth in Revolt) has been cast in the New York premiere of Gay Bride of Frankenstein, a 'comic-book-rock-musical' that begins its run at the New York Musical Theatre Festival on September 28. Wright joins fellow Spring Awakening alum, Emma Hunton, completing an outstanding cast which includes Darryl Winslow (Avenue Q, Evil Dead, Unlock'd - NYMF), Jeremiah James (Carousel - London), Dana Aber, Christian D. White, Christopher Hudson Myers and Ashley Kate Adams.

NYMF's 4th Annual 'Next Broadway Sensation' Competition Begins 9/13, Open Auditions Held 8/29

New York Musical Theatre Festival's 'Next Broadway Sensation,' formerly known as 'Broadway Idol,' returns for its fourth year. Diana DeGarmo, 'American Idol' (Season 3) runner-up, now in The Toxic Avenger at New World Stages, will serve as host for the competition's first round on September 13; celebrity hosts for the semifinals on September 20 and the Broadway Sensation October 4 finale will be announced shortly. Confirmed judges include Jonathan Groff (Spring Awakening, upcoming film Taking Woodstock), Bailey Hanks and Orfeh (Legally Blonde), composer/lyricist Paul Scott Goodman (Rooms), Kacie Sheik and Allison Case (Hair), and record producer Noah Cornman of Sh-k-boom Records... With more to be announced.

CLEAR BLUE TUESDAY Comes To The NY Musical Theatre Festival 9/10

The New York Musical Theatre Festival will proudly present the World Premiere of Clear Blue Tuesday, a musical movie by Elizabeth Lucas on Thursday, September 10 at both 7pm and 9:15pm. The screenings will take place at the School of Visual Arts (SVA) Theatre (333 West 23rd Street between 8th and 9th Avenues).

Grammy Award Winner Ashanti Joins Washington And More In Boys & Girls Clubs Of America's Youth Advocacy Campaign

As part of Boys & Girls Clubs of America's (BGCA) new advocacy campaign - BE GREAT - Grammy Award-winning singer/songwriter, actress and Boys & Girls Club alum Ashanti will unveil a new billboard in Times Square on August 11, featuring her childhood picture and an aspirational message - BE AMAZING. Ashanti joins some 25 prominent alumni in the new advocacy campaign to help increase public awareness and understanding about the key issues facing America's youth, and the positive impact of Clubs.

The 2008 Broadcast of the 62nd Annual Tony Awards Nabs Two Emmy Noms

The June 2008 broadcast of the 62nd Annual Tony Awards was honored today with two Prime Time Emmy Award nominations in the Outstanding Special Class Programs Category & Outstanding Technical Direction, Camerawork, Video Control For A Miniseries, Movie Or A Special Category. The nominations were announced live this morning from the Leonard H. Goldenson Theatre in North Hollywood by actors Chandra Wilson and Jim Parsons.

63rd Annual Tony Awards To Simulcast Live In Times Square 6/7

The 63rd Annual Tony Awards will be one of the first events to take place in the newly re-designed Times Square. The Tony Awards will be simulcast in its entirety from Radio City Music Hall, to the Clear Channel Spectacolor Screen in Times Square, live on Sunday, June 7th from 7:00 p.m. - 11:00 p.m.

Jerry Herman, Virginia's Signature Theatre, Shirley Herz and Phyllis Newman Honored at the Tony Awards Telecast 6/7

The Tony Administration Committee revealed the names of a quartet of honorees who are to be recognized in the four non-competitive Tony categories. Composer/lyricist Jerry Herman, Virginia's Signature Theatre, and longtime press agent Shirley Herz will be honored at the 63rd annual Tony Awards ceremony on June 7. Actress/writer Phyllis Newman will receive the newest Tony Award for her volunteer work as an advocate for women's health.

Tovah Feldshuh To Co-Host Tony Awards Live Broadcast 6/7 In Times Square

Four-time Tony Nominee Tovah Feldshuh, currently starring on Broadway in Irena's Vow, will be co-hosting the unprecedented, live broadcast of the Tony Awards in Duffy Square on Sunday, June 7. The Tony Awards has partnered with the Times Square Alliance to simulcast the entire Tony Awards program from Radio City Music Hall, on the Clear Channel Spectacolor Screen in Times Square.

TONY Award Representatives To Ring NASDAQ MarketSite Bell Today 6/5

Representatives from the 63rd Annual Antoinette Perry 'Tony' Awards will visit the NASDAQ MarketSite in New York City's Times Square. The 63rd Annual Antoinette Perry 'Tony' Awards will take place on Sunday, June 7th, live from Radio City Music Hall. The Tony Awards will air live on CBS from 8:00-11:00PM (ET/PT time delay). The Tonys are presented by The Broadway League and The American Theatre Wing.
